How they compare
Malta currently reports 103.59 against 99.16 in Continente, a difference of 4.43.
The two have swapped places 5 times across 28 shared years of data; in 1996 it was Continente ahead.
Continente ranks 7th and Malta ranks 5th of 21 regions.
Malta has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Continente | Malta |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 99.01 | 100.5 | 1.48 | Malta |
| 2000s | 97.84 | 99.02 | 1.18 | Malta |
| 2010s | 96.49 | 101.95 | 5.46 | Malta |
| 2020s | 98.56 | 105.89 | 7.34 | Malta |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
